Hi, I got help on using custom CSS to just remove the site title on my blog so that I can still have my tag line but also have a title show up in the wordpress reader. Here’s the CSS they gave me to use for that:
.logo-text h1 {
display: none;
}However now the title shows on my mobile site. How can I fix it so that it won’t show on the mobile site? Thanks!

Ah yes, now I’m seeing it. Let’s be a little more specific with the selector. Replace the code you were using with the following.
header .logo-text h1 { display: none; } -
